In continuation of MusiCares and Sober 21's sobriety-focused series, Musicians In Recovery, Will-Dog Abers and Darren Waller shared their inspiring journeys to sobriety.
The GRAMMY-winning Ozomatli bassist/composer and NFL star/artist and producer had an in-depth discussion of the unique challenges of getting sober as well-known personalities, and the doors that opened once they started over in recovery. The hour-long panel was moderated by Elia Einhorn, founder of Sober 21, and Brendan Berry, MusiCares' Mental Health & Addiction Services Client Manager.
